TURN-208: Gatevale turnstile counters at the Merrow Field pilot double-count when a rotation reverses mid-cycle. Attendance totals drift roughly 2% high per event. The debounce window fix is implemented, reviewed by Ilsa, and soak-tested across two simulated match days without drift. Ready for your cut; the candidate build is identified below.

trace token, tagag-tafog: htk6_5ed18c

**Vendor note: Inkmill markdown pipeline**

Rendering for Parchway docs is outsourced to Inkmill under an annual contract, renewing each March. They handle sanitization and PDF export; we own the upload queue. SLA: 4-hour response on rendering failures. Escalate only after two failed retries. Their support desk is reachable at the address below.

billing contact of hahaf-baguf = zorael.tammir.jorius@sivrelhq.internal

Finance Review Summary — Hiring Freeze, Installations Division

For the finance team: effective immediately, Tarnwell Engineering has frozen hiring in the Installations division pending the mid-year cost review. Open requisitions are paused, not cancelled; contractor extensions require controller sign-off. Payroll forecasts should be restated on current headcount. The confidential note below describes the plans this freeze is intended to support.

internal memo for kawip-hadug: Headcount on the Wenwyn team goes from 7 to 140 by the end of January. Gross margin on Wenwyn came in at 20 percent against a plan of 15 percent.